
简介
该用户还未填写简介
擅长的技术栈
可提供的服务
暂无可提供的服务
备注:Hive 版本 2.1.1文章目录一.Hive函数概述1.1 Hive函数分类1.2 查看Hive函数1.2.1 show functions命令1.2.2 DESCRIBE 命令二.Hive的数值函数2.1 round函数2.2 floor函数2.3 ceil函数2.4 rand()2.5 power函数2.6 sqrt函数2.7 bin2.8 abs函数2.9 greatest函数2.1
文章目录一.Django入门1.1 建立项目1.1.1 制定规范1.1.2 建立虚拟环境1.1.3 安装virtualenv1.1.4 激活虚拟环境1.1.5 安装Django1.1.6 在Django中创建项目1.1.7 创建数据库1.1.8 查看项目1.2 创建应用程序1.2.1 定义模型1.2.2 激活模型1.2.3 Django管理网站1.2.4 定义模型Entry1.2.5 迁移模型En
文章目录一.while循环简介1.1 使用while 循环1.2 让用户选择何时退出1.3 使用标志1.4 使用break 退出循环1.5 在循环中使用continue二.使用while 循环来处理列表和字典2.1 在列表之间移动元素2.2 删除包含特定值的所有列表元素2.3 使用用户输入来填充字典参考:一.while循环简介for 循环用于针对集合中的每个元素都一个代码块,而while 循环不断
备注:Hive 版本 2.1.1一.模拟误删表误删除了这张表hive>> drop table ods_fact_sale_orc;OK二.从回收站恢复表查看回收表[root@hp1 ~]# hadoop fs -ls /user/root/.Trash/Current/user/hive/warehouse/test.dbFound 2 itemsdrwxrwxrwt- root h
备注:Hive 版本 2.1.1文章目录一.Hive的DML(数据操作语言)概述二.Load 命令2.1 数据准备2.2 将服务器文件加载到hive表2.3 将HDFS文件加载到hive表三.INSERT INTO TABLE FROM Query3.1 Insert into select 语句3.2 Insert overwrite select语句3.3 multiple inserts3.
备注:Hive 版本 2.1.1文章目录一.Hive归档简介二.Hive 归档操作参考一.Hive归档简介由于HDFS的设计,文件系统中的文件数量直接影响namenode中的内存消耗。虽然对于小型集群来说通常不是问题,但当有5000w -1亿个文件时,单个机器上的内存使用可能会达到可访问内存的极限。在这种情况下,尽可能少的文件是有利的。使用Hadoop Archives是减少分区中文件数量的一种方
一.ZooKeeper简介ZooKeeper是一个集中的服务,用于维护配置信息、命名、提供分布式同步和提供组服务。所有这些类型的服务都被分布式应用程序以某种形式使用。每次实现它们时,都要做大量工作来修复不可避免的bug和竞争条件。由于实现这些类型的服务很困难,应用程序最初通常忽略它们,这使得它们在出现更改时很脆弱,难以管理。即使正确执行,这些服务的不同实现也会在部署应用程序时导致管理复杂性。Zoo
备注:Hive 版本 2.1.1文章目录一.Hive锁概述二.Hive 锁相关操作2.1 Hive的并发性2.2 查看表的锁2.3 解锁三.Hive 事务表锁机制四.Hive 锁测试参考:一.Hive锁概述Hive支持如下两种类型的锁:1.Shared (S)2.Exclusive (X)顾名思义,可以同时获取多个共享锁,而X锁阻塞所有其他锁。兼容性矩阵如下:对于某些操作,锁本质上是分层的——例如
备注:Hive 版本 2.1.1文章目录一.Hive事务简介1.1 为什么要支持ACID1.2 hive事务的限制二.Hive 事务表测试2.1 修改配置文件2.2 重启hive服务2.3 验证acid参考一.Hive事务简介1.1 为什么要支持ACID事务的四个属性:1.原子性(Atomic)(Atomicity)事务必须是原子工作单元;对于其数据修改,要么全都执行,要么全都不执行。通常,与某个
概述:Oracle scott用户下四张表1.部门表--dept2.员工表--emp3.工资等级表--salgrade4.奖金表--bonusdept-- Create tablecreate table DEPT(deptno NUMBER(2) not null,dnameVAR...